2017-12-02 4 views
1

ブロックチェーンAPI v2経由で支払いを送信しようとしています。私はPHPを使用して&カール。ブロックチェーンAPI ::支払いエラーを送信する

blockchain財布サービス: Node.jsのV 0.26.0:8.9.0 V

私は、ビットコインのアドレスを生成し、私のバランスを取得し、私の財布との対話が、不明な理由で、私がすることはできませんAPIを介して支払いを送ってください、私は答えのための多くのウェブサイトを参照してください助けてください。

私のPHPコードの支払い送信する(ちょうどテスト):コンソール上

$my_api_key = 'xxxxx'; 
$guid='xxxxx'; 
$firstpassword='xxxx'; 
$second_password = "xxxx"; 
$amount = '30000'; 
$to = '1AQDhKrjvAonjLAUv4PzM9NjGzZZ4HEpU1'; 
$fee = '2000'; 

$root_url = 'http://localhost:3000/merchant/'.$guid.'/payment'; 
$parameters = 'to='.$to.'&amount='.$amount.'&password='.$firstpassword.'&fee='.$fee.'&second_password='.$second_password; 

$response = Curl::to($root_url . '?' . $parameters)->get(); 


return $response; 

を私は次のエラーを取得する: - エラー:[オブジェクトのオブジェクト]は、応答は私を与える:{「エラー」:」予想外のエラーです。もう一度お試しください。」}

私のパスワードと私のAPIコード+私のウォレットIDは、どちらも100%正確です。

答えて

0

この試してみてください:あなたはこの試みることができる

$address = null; 
 

 
try { 
 
    // Uncomment to send 
 
    // var_dump($Blockchain->Wallet->send($address, "0.001")); 
 
} catch (\Blockchain\Exception\ApiError $e) { 
 
    echo $e->getMessage() . '<br />'; 
 
} 
 

 
// Multi-recipient format 
 
$recipients = array(); 
 
$recipients[$address] = "0.001"; 
 

 
try { 
 
    // Uncomment to send 
 
// var_dump($Blockchain->Wallet->sendMany($recipients)); 
 
} catch (Blockchain_ApiError $e) { 
 
echo $e->getMessage() . '<br />'; 
 
}

0

を:

まず最初に、あなたはblockchain財布サービスは、ポート3000上のサーバー上で実行されていることを確認する必要がありますブラウザでURLを押すことでブロックチェーンウォレットサービスの動作を確認することができます。つまり、http://localhost:3000です。ブロックチェーンのウォレットサービスが実行中であることを意味する応答エラー "Not found"が表示された場合?

http://localhost:3000/merchant/ $ GUID/sendmanyパスワード= $ main_password & second_password = $ second_password &受信者$受信者&料金= $料=

: 、一度に多くのユーザーにbitcoinsを送信するには、以下のAPIを使用することができます

ここで、$ guidはブロックチェーンのウォレットID、$ main_passwordはウォレットの最初のパスワード、$ second_passwordはウォレットの第2のパスワード、2番目のパスワードはON、$ recipientはキーと値としてのアドレスを受け取るJSONオブジェクトです、$手数料は取引手数料であり、オプションのデフォルト取引手数料以上でなければなりません。

$受信者が

{ 
    "1JzSZFs2DQke2B3S4pBxaNaMzzVZaG4Cqh": 100000000, 
    "12Cf6nCcRtKERh9cQm3Z29c9MWvQuFSxvT": 1500000000, 
    "1dice6YgEVBf88erBFra9BHf6ZMoyvG88": 200000000 
} 
ようになるオブジェクト
関連する問題